1. Two wireless microphone systems on nearby frequencies cause intermodulation products that land on a third system's frequency. This is best resolved by:
Recalculating and assigning intermod-free frequencies using coordination software

Intermodulation is solved by using frequency coordination software to calculate and assign frequencies that avoid IM products on active channels.

3. What standard sample rate and bit depth is used by the AES67 networked audio interoperability standard?
48 kHz / 24-bit (primary reference, with others supported)

AES67 specifies 48 kHz as the primary reference sample rate and supports 16- and 24-bit linear PCM, though 96 kHz is also supported as an option.

4. What is jitter in a digital audio system?
Timing variations in the digital clock that cause audible noise or distortion

Jitter is the variation in timing of the digital sampling clock; even small inconsistencies can cause phase noise and distortion in the reconstructed audio signal.

6. What does the acronym AES/EBU stand for in professional audio?
Audio Engineering Society / European Broadcasting Union

AES/EBU (Audio Engineering Society / European Broadcasting Union) is a standard digital audio interface that carries two channels of digital audio over a balanced 110 Ω XLR cable.
